Enhancing Business Management Skills for Event Logistics Procurement

Event logistics procurement is crucial to the success of any event. Those responsible for managing the business side of event logistics must possess strong skills in planning, organization, and execution. This article highlights essential business management skills needed to excel in event logistics procurement. Strategic Planning Skills Strategic planning is the foundation of effective event logistics procurement. An event logistics manager must be able to carefully plan each step, from initial planning to post-event evaluation. This involves setting event goals, budgeting, and prioritizing tasks that need to be completed. Vendor Negotiation and Management Negotiation skills are vital when dealing with vendors and potential partners. An event logistics manager must negotiate prices, contract terms, and services offered by vendors. Maintaining good relationships with vendors, including selection, evaluation, and fostering mutually beneficial partnerships, is also critical. Efficient Budget Management Budget management is a crucial element in event logistics procurement. The logistics manager must be able to create a realistic budget and manage it efficiently throughout the event process. This includes allocating resources to various aspects such as transportation, accommodation, catering, and technical needs. Risk and Crisis Management Risks and crises are unavoidable in event logistics. A competent logistics manager must identify potential risks, develop mitigation strategies, and respond quickly if a crisis occurs. The ability to remain calm and take appropriate action in critical situations is highly valued. Understanding Technology and Innovation The use of technology and innovation can enhance efficiency in event logistics procurement. A logistics manager should understand various technological platforms that can assist in event planning and execution. This includes online invitation management, event apps, and monitoring systems that help measure event success. Strong Organizational Skills An event logistics manager must have strong organizational skills to manage various aspects of an event simultaneously. This includes scheduling, task delegation, and monitoring the progress of each part of the logistics process. Good organization ensures that every element of the event runs according to plan. Effective Communication Skills Good communication skills are essential in event logistics procurement. A logistics manager must communicate clearly and effectively with internal teams, vendors, and event participants. Persuasion and diplomacy are also needed when interacting with various parties involved in the event. Deep Understanding of Client Expectations Understanding the desires and expectations of clients or event organizers is crucial. A logistics manager needs to have interview and analysis skills to gather sufficient information about the event’s goals, target audience, and client expectations. This helps in crafting a logistics procurement strategy that aligns with the event’s needs and objectives. Flexibility and Creativity In the event world, things don’t always go as planned. Flexibility is a highly needed skill to handle sudden changes or challenges during the logistics procurement process. Creativity is also important to add a unique and innovative touch to the event. Ability to Evaluate and Improve Performance A good logistics manager focuses not only on event execution but also on post-event evaluation. The ability to evaluate event performance, consider participant feedback, and note what worked and what needs improvement is crucial for enhancing the quality of future logistics procurement. Conclusion Event logistics procurement requires a diverse set of business management skills. By mastering strategic planning, negotiation, efficient budget management, and risk management, a logistics manager can tackle challenges and achieve event success. Additionally, effective communication skills, a deep understanding of client expectations, and flexibility in responding to changes are key to delivering high-quality event logistics services. By honing these skills, a logistics manager can become the driving force behind the success of every event they manage. Maintaining Hospitality Industry Knowledge for a Laundry Attendant

In the hospitality industry, the role of a laundry attendant is crucial in ensuring the cleanliness and comfort of guests. For a laundry attendant, maintaining knowledge of the hospitality industry goes beyond daily tasks; it involves understanding industry developments and standards. Importance of Broad Knowledge Beyond mastering their specific role, a laundry attendant should also be familiar with other areas within the industry. This broad knowledge base is valuable as it demonstrates a well-rounded understanding and the ability to contribute beyond one’s immediate responsibilities. This article outlines ways to maintain hospitality industry knowledge to help a laundry attendant stay relevant and advance in their career. Keeping Up with Technology and Equipment The hospitality industry is continuously evolving with technological innovations and advanced equipment. A laundry attendant should actively update their knowledge of the latest equipment that can enhance efficiency and service quality. Attending training and workshops related to laundry technology, such as the latest washing machines, inventory management systems, and innovative detergents, is recommended. Participating in Training Programs and Certifications Various training programs and certifications in the hospitality industry can help laundry attendants deepen their understanding of laundry processes, risk management, and compliance with hygiene standards. Engaging in such programs not only enhances technical skills but also provides formal recognition of expertise. Joining Professional Associations or Communities Professional associations or communities in the hospitality industry offer excellent platforms for sharing experiences, obtaining the latest information, and networking with peers. Laundry attendants can join associations such as the International Executive Housekeepers Association (IEHA) or The Association for Linen Management (ALM) to engage in discussions, seminars, and idea exchanges. Staying Informed About Hospitality Industry News Remaining informed about trends, policies, and the latest news in the hospitality industry is crucial. Taking time to read industry publications, follow specialized hospitality news websites, and follow social media accounts focused on the industry can help laundry attendants stay connected with current developments. Understanding Current Hygiene and Safety Standards The hospitality industry’s hygiene and safety standards are constantly changing, especially in the context of public health and safety. Laundry attendants need to understand these changes and ensure they follow best practices. Participating in the latest hygiene and safety training, particularly during emergencies like pandemics, will help laundry attendants become valuable resources for the hotel. Understanding Inventory and Logistics Management Laundry attendants are not just responsible for washing clothes but also contribute to the hotel’s inventory and logistics management. Understanding inventory management processes, stock monitoring systems, and coordination with other hotel departments are essential aspects of a laundry attendant’s job. Participating in training related to inventory and logistics management is advisable. Sharing Experiences with Colleagues Sharing experiences with colleagues, especially those working in other hotel departments, can provide new perspectives and valuable information. Discussing daily challenges, exchanging tips, and learning best practices from colleagues can enhance cooperation and enrich your knowledge. Participating in Self-Development Initiatives In addition to formal training, it is important for laundry attendants to take the initiative in self-development. Engaging in online courses, webinars, or reading books related to the hospitality industry can be an effective way to enhance personal knowledge and skills. Understanding Guest Needs and Market Trends As part of the hospitality industry, a laundry attendant needs to understand guest needs and preferences. Analyzing market trends and following guest feedback can help create more responsive and customer-oriented laundry services. Participating in Hotel Projects and Service Updates Involvement in hotel projects that involve service updates or improvements can provide insights into how the hospitality industry adapts to change. It also offers laundry attendants opportunities to engage in broader hotel initiatives and understand overall operational dynamics. Conclusion Maintaining hospitality industry knowledge is key for a laundry attendant to remain relevant and advance in their career. By staying updated on technology, joining professional associations, participating in training, and actively following industry news, a laundry attendant can become a valuable asset to a hotel. This approach enables them to understand the full scope of the hospitality industry and make a greater contribution to the comfort and cleanliness of hotel guests. Making Your Indonesian Cuisine Appealing on Social Media : A Tips and Tricks

Indonesia, with its rich cultural and culinary diversity, has garnered worldwide attention as a top culinary destination. Each region boasts its unique dishes, some of which have gained international popularity, even ranking among the world’s top 100 tastiest dishes. The rapid growth of social media has accelerated the dissemination of information, making it easier for people abroad to discover Indonesian cuisine. Given the popularity of social media, presenting Indonesian food aesthetically can significantly enhance its appeal. Here are some tips and tricks to make Indonesian cuisine more captivating on social media: Aesthetic Presentation and Arrangement To attract attention on social media, it’s crucial to arrange and present the food aesthetically. Place the food neatly and creatively on a visually appealing plate or container. Choosing contrasting and harmonious colors can make the food visually appetizing. Focus on Details and Textures The details and textures of the food can be a major draw. Highlight textures such as crispy crusts, enticing sauces, or additional garnishes that add visual dimension. Using close-up photography can help emphasize these details, making the food more appealing and intriguing to those who have never tried it. Play with Refreshing Colors Color is an essential element in food photography. Indonesian cuisine is known for its use of rich spices and seasonings, creating vibrant colors that can stimulate the appetite. Emphasizing the natural colors of these ingredients can enhance the visual appeal, especially with proper lighting to make the colors pop. Unique Composition Creations Create unique compositions by carefully arranging food elements. Play with the height and position of these elements to add visual depth to the photo. Adding garnishes such as fresh leaves or spices can enhance the composition’s beauty. Story Behind the Dish Add a story behind the dish you present. Share the origin of the food, the inspiration behind the recipe, or personal experiences related to the dish. Connecting food with a narrative can make it more interesting and make the audience curious to learn more. Consider Layout and Background The photo layout and background selection are also important. Choose a clean and uncluttered background to keep the focus on the food. Avoid overly distracting backgrounds so the food remains the main highlight. Use Popular Hashtags Using relevant and popular hashtags can help increase the visibility of your food photos on social media. Find hashtags frequently used in the culinary or Indonesian food community and include them in your captions or photo comments. Utilize Optimal Natural Light Good lighting is key to attractive food photos. Make the most of natural light, especially when shooting outdoors. Avoid using flash, which can create unwanted shadows and spoil the food’s appearance. Subtle Photo Filters or Editing When editing photos, avoid using overly heavy filters that can alter the food’s original colors. Use subtle filters or edits to enhance photo quality without losing the authentic characteristics of the Indonesian cuisine you’re showcasing. Engage with Your Audience Allow your audience to participate by asking questions or inviting them to share their experiences with Indonesian cuisine. Respond to comments and interactions positively, as this can increase engagement and strengthen your relationship with your followers. Promote Engagement with Contests or Giveaways Besides sharing food photos, hold contests or giveaways to encourage audience participation. Ask them to share their favorite Indonesian food photos with attractive prizes. This can increase interaction and create a more active community around your culinary content. Learn from Experience and Feedback Always be open to learning and growing. Learn from previous posting experiences and accept feedback from your followers. This can help you understand audience preferences and improve the overall quality of your content. Consistency in Visual Branding Maintain consistency in your visual style. From color choices and filters to layout, ensure your visual brand is consistent across all posts. This will help build a strong identity in the eyes of your followers. Explore Video Platforms In addition to photos, consider uploading short videos showcasing the cooking process or giving brief reviews of Indonesian dishes. Videos can add an extra dimension and attract more attention on social media. By applying these tips and tricks, you can ensure that the Indonesian dishes you present on social media not only look delicious but also attract greater interest and engagement from your audience. Creativity, consistency, and a personal touch will help you build a strong presence in the digital culinary world. The Importance of Effective Communication for Bellboys in the Hospitality Industry

In the hospitality industry, bellboys play a crucial role in creating a positive guest experience. One of the key skills required by a bellboy is the ability to communicate effectively. This article discusses the importance of effective communication for bellboys and its impact on the service provided to guests. Making a Strong First Impression Bellboys are often the first hotel staff members to meet guests upon arrival. The ability to provide a warm and informative welcome is vital in creating a strong first impression. Effective communication in conveying information about hotel services, facilities, and check-in procedures gives guests confidence that they have chosen the right place to stay. Providing Local Orientation and Information Bellboys are responsible for orienting guests about the hotel’s location and surrounding area. Effective communication in providing information about local attractions, nearby restaurants, and public transportation helps guests plan their activities better. The ability to offer informative and relevant suggestions also enriches the guest experience, especially for those unfamiliar with the area. Clear Explanation of Hotel Facilities A bellboy should be able to clearly explain the various facilities available at the hotel, including fitness centers, swimming pools, room service, and other amenities. Effective communication in this regard helps guests make full use of the hotel’s offerings, enhancing their overall satisfaction during their stay. Efficient Handling of Luggage An integral part of a bellboy’s job is handling guests’ luggage. Effective communication is key when interacting with guests to identify any special needs or requests related to their luggage. Providing clear information about the luggage handling process, including delivery and pick-up times, ensures a smooth and comfortable experience for guests. Conveying Guest Messages or Requests to Relevant Departments Bellboys often act as intermediaries between guests and various hotel departments. The ability to convey guests’ messages or requests clearly and accurately to the relevant department ensures that guests’ needs are well met. Effective communication in this aspect helps maintain good coordination among hotel staff to deliver consistent service. Responding to Guest Inquiries and Complaints Bellboys often face guest inquiries or situations where guests may have complaints or special needs. The ability to respond promptly and provide clear answers is a crucial communication skill. Effective communication helps address guest discomfort or confusion, fostering a positive relationship. Coordination with Other Hotel Service Teams Effective communication is not only needed when interacting with guests but also in coordinating with other hotel service teams. Bellboys must communicate with receptionists, housekeeping, and other staff to ensure smooth hotel operations. This includes providing accurate and timely information regarding room status changes, cleaning schedules, or special guest requests. Arranging Transportation and Off-Hotel Activities Bellboys are often responsible for arranging guest transportation, such as taxis or shuttle services. The ability to communicate with drivers or third parties involved in the process is essential to ensure guests arrive or depart smoothly. Bellboys can also provide information about off-hotel activities, such as local tours or special events, enhancing the guest experience. Striving to Be Multilingual In an increasingly global hospitality environment, the ability to communicate in multiple languages is a significant advantage for a bellboy. Being able to speak a language understood by international guests helps create a more personalized experience and avoids misunderstandings that may arise due to language barriers. Building Guest Relationships and Loyalty Effective communication helps build strong relationships with guests. Bellboys who can understand guests’ needs and preferences and respond warmly and informatively can create a lasting positive impression. This can positively impact guest loyalty, making them more likely to return to the hotel and recommend it to others. Conclusion In the hospitality industry, bellboys serve as the first ambassadors of the hotel’s service. Their ability to communicate effectively not only creates a positive experience for guests but also helps maintain smooth hotel operations. By clearly conveying information, responding quickly to guest needs, and working closely with the hotel team, bellboys play a key role in delivering superior service. Therefore, developing effective communication skills is a must for bellboys who wish to excel in this dynamic industry. Basic First Aid Knowledge: Importance for Room Attendants in Professional Certification

In the hospitality industry, room attendants play a crucial role in maintaining the cleanliness and comfort of guest rooms. However, beyond their routine tasks, basic first aid knowledge is also a critical competency. This article explains the importance of first aid knowledge for room attendants in the context of professional certification. Awareness of Accidents and Emergencies Due to the nature of their work, which involves interacting with various hotel facilities and equipment, room attendants need to be aware of potential accidents or emergencies. Basic first aid knowledge provides them with the foundation to recognize and respond quickly and effectively to emergencies such as fires, accidents, or urgent medical conditions. First Aid for Minor Accidents Basic first aid includes the ability to provide assistance in cases of minor accidents or injuries. Room attendants may encounter situations such as minor cuts, slips, or falls within the hotel. With an understanding of how to clean and treat minor wounds, room attendants can assist guests and prevent further complications. Responding to Medical Emergencies In addition to physical accidents, room attendants may also face medical emergencies such as heart attacks, asthma attacks, or fainting. Basic first aid equips them with the necessary skills to provide initial assistance before professional medical help arrives. The ability to call for immediate help and provide early care can make a significant difference in medical emergencies. Understanding First Aid Equipment Room attendants need to understand how to use first aid equipment, which is commonly available in hotels. This includes using bandages, portable fire extinguishers, or even emergency breathing aids. Knowledge of how to effectively use this equipment can help prevent the escalation of injuries or respond quickly when first aid is needed. Emergency Area Evacuation and Safety Room attendants should also be prepared for situations requiring quick evacuation, such as fires or security threats. Basic first aid knowledge includes understanding evacuation procedures, guiding guests to safe assembly points, and providing necessary instructions. The ability to act quickly and in an organized manner can help save lives and minimize risks during emergencies. Handling Hazardous Chemicals Room attendants often deal with various cleaning products and chemicals in guest rooms. Knowledge of how to handle chemicals safely and recognize signs of hazardous exposure is a crucial part of basic first aid knowledge. This helps protect both the room attendants and guests from the health risks posed by chemical exposure. Specialized Emergency Response Training Some hotels offer specialized training for room attendants on handling emergencies that may occur within the hotel environment. This includes knowledge of specific hotel evacuation procedures, how to assist guests who may require first aid, and coordination with hotel security teams. Such specialized training ensures that room attendants are prepared to face unique emergency situations in their workplace. Understanding the Accident Reporting Process Basic first aid knowledge also involves understanding the process of reporting accidents. Room attendants should know how to report incidents or emergencies to hotel management or relevant authorities. Timely and accurate reporting is essential for evaluating and mitigating potential future accident risks. Sensitivity to Guests’ Special Needs During emergencies, room attendants also need to be sensitive to guests’ special needs. This may include the needs of guests with disabilities, small children, or those requiring special attention during emergencies. Basic first aid knowledge includes understanding how to provide appropriate assistance based on individual needs. Enhancing Reputation and Guest Trust In the context of professional certification, basic first aid knowledge adds value to room attendants. Guests who are aware of their safety are more likely to feel comfortable and confident when staying at a hotel staffed by personnel trained in first aid. This can enhance the hotel’s reputation and build guest trust in the staff’s ability to handle various situations. Conclusion Basic first aid knowledge is a critical skill that room attendants in the hospitality industry must possess. In the context of professional certification, this knowledge provides a strong foundation for delivering safe and responsive service to guests. A room attendant equipped with basic first aid knowledge not only performs routine tasks with expertise but also becomes a vital pillar in ensuring safety and security within the hotel environment. Investing in professional certification that includes basic first aid knowledge can have a significant positive impact on guest experiences and the overall reputation of the hotel.
